A superbly improved, 2 bedroom Victorian house, well situated for access to the city centre and Cambridge mainline railway station.

City Centre three quarters of a mile, Mainline Railway Station (Liverpool Street and King's Cross lines) a third of a mile, Addenbrooke's Hospital/ Biomedical Campus 2.25 miles (distances are approximate).

Constructed with brick elevations under a slate roof, 25 Hooper Street dates from the Victorian era and retains many of its charming period features. The property has been the subject of a programme of improvements and extension to the rear and most recently has been redecorated inside and out, and the wood flooring to the ground floor has been sanded. The property now offers prospective purchasers the chance to acquire a charming home with well-presented accommodation throughout.

Hooper Street is situated on the east side of the city, only a short walk from the Grafton and Beehive shopping centres. The property is also conveniently placed for access to the historic city centre with its numerous shopping and leisure facilities, and Cambridge mainline railway station with services to King's Cross and Liverpool Street in about 52 and 67 minutes respectively. There is a wide range of vibrant shops and restaurants in nearby Mill Road and Cambridge Leisure Park is also within easy reach.
